Telluride Film Festival co-founder Tom Luddy dies at 79


Tom Luddy, who co-founded the Telluride Film Festival as part of a long and varied career in the film industry, has died at age 79. Luddy died Monday in Berkeley following a long illness, according to a representative for the Telluride Film Festival. Together with Bill and Stella Pence and James Card, Luddy founded the Telluride Film Festival in 1974.
